One of the most critical aspects of plating line safety is the implementation of comprehensive training programs for all employees. Workers must be educated about the hazardous materials and various chemicals they may come into contact with. Regular training sessions should cover both the proper handling of these substances and the correct use of personal protective equipment (PPE). This proactive approach empowers employees to recognize risks and adopt safe practices daily.

Another vital safety measure is the installation of adequate ventilation systems in plating areas. Many plating processes emit harmful fumes and vapors, which can pose severe health risks if inhaled. Adequate ventilation not only helps to maintain air quality but also decreases the likelihood of accidents related to chemical exposure. Implementing a combination of local exhaust ventilation and general air circulation systems is crucial for creating a safer working environment.

Routine inspections and maintenance of the plating line equipment cannot be overlooked. Regular checks ensure that all machinery operates smoothly and any potential hazards are identified before they become serious issues. Companies should establish a clear schedule for inspections and audits, allowing for prompt repairs and upgrades to equipment. This proactive approach helps to minimize downtime and boosts overall productivity.

Safety signage is another critical measure that can enhance awareness and compliance. Clearly displayed warnings and instructions in high-risk areas serve as constant reminders for employees to follow safety protocols. Signage should be visible and use easily understood language or symbols, ensuring quick comprehension in an often fast-paced workplace.

Emergency preparedness is a crucial aspect of any safety program, especially in plating lines. It is essential to have clear emergency response plans documented and communicated to all employees. Regular drills should be conducted to practice evacuation procedures and the use of emergency equipment, such as eye wash stations and fire extinguishers. This familiarity can significantly reduce chaos and panic in actual emergency situations, potentially saving lives and minimizing injuries.

Another effective approach to enhancing safety is the ergonomic design of workstations. By adjusting the height and layout of plating lines to suit the natural movements of workers, companies can reduce strain and fatigue. Ergonomically designed workspaces facilitate a comfortable work environment, which can lead to improved focus and decreased chances of accidents due to discomfort or distraction.

Moreover, regular health assessments for employees are an essential component of a holistic safety program. Monitoring health conditions related to exposure to chemicals can help detect early signs of work-related illnesses. This not only ensures employee well-being but also fosters a culture of safety within the organization.

Finally, engaging employees in safety discussions and decision-making can lead to enhanced safety measures. Encouraging workers to share their experiences and suggestions for improving safety can create a more inclusive workplace culture, where employees feel valued and empowered. Cross-functional teams can be established to make recommendations for safety policies and practices, ensuring that the insights of those who work on the front lines are incorporated.
